Structural and Functional Characterization of Plasmodium falciparum Nicotinic Acid Mononucleotide Adenylyltransferase

P. falciparum nicotinic acid mononucleotide adenylyltransferase was characterized. Two X-ray structures—in complex with NaAD and with an ATP analog—were obtained. Two active site cysteines are likely to be involved in redox regulation of PfNaMNAT. PfNaMNAT utilizes NaMN and nicotinamide mononucleotide, emphasizing its potential as a drug target.
